Founding of CENTURY 21 Mid-State Realty L.L.C.

Our President and Founder

        
About
 
CENTURY 21 Mid-State Realty L.L.C.
(formerly: Tims Ford Lake Real Estate)
 
            Founded in 1994 by Pamela Sargent-Peck, the current president, CENTURY 21 Mid-State Realty L.L.C. has maintained a superior professional place in the Franklin County real estate market. The company offers a wide range of services to its clients, including the resources of the Middle Tennessee Association of Realtors, as well as the Franklin County Chamber of Commerce and surrounding Chambers of Commerce.
 
            Initially, located at 400 Main Street, Decherd, Tennessee, the company opened with 2 employees in a 2 room office. The main office is now located at 1810 Sharp Springs Road, Winchester, Tennessee with more than 5000 square feet of floor space which includes sales offices and private conference and agent training rooms. There is a large parking area for your convenience. In May, 1997, Pam expanded into Coffee County with an additional office in Manchester, TN.  Pam expanded once more in May, 2005 with the third office currently  located at 50 West College Street, Monteagle, Tennessee. On October 31, 2006, Pam opened the companies fourth office which is now located at 101 West Lincoln St, Suite 100, Tullahoma, Tennessee. The Manchester and Tullahoma Offices have merged to provide the best quality service for the Coffee County area.

            Prior to founding her company, Pam Peck was among the top leaders in real estate sales and management in Cabarrus County, North Carolina for eleven years. Having earned a degree in Business Administration and Interior Design, her skills, expertise, tenacity, artistry, and the ease with which she handled public relations were recognized statewide. She became the Marketing Director for a well-known multi-million-dollar development company, during which time she coordinated the development of 102 condominium units in the most prestigious condominium parks in that area of North Carolina. She served as State Treasurer for the North Carolina Home Builders Association Womens's Council in 1988-89.
